When cells grow old or become damaged, they die and new cells take their place. Sometimes this orderly process breaks down, and abnormal or damaged cells grow and multiply when they shouldn’t. These cells may form tumors.

Dertemine the maximum volume of the air breathed in during the period of rest for each minute
pshichka [43]

The maximum volume of air breathed in during the period of rest for each minute is 500 ml also known as tidal volume.

Tidal volume is simply each breath a person takes. It is a significant factor in both minute and alveolar ventilation. The quantity of air that enters the lungs each minute is measured by minute ventilation also referred to as total ventilation. It is a function of both tidal volume and respiratory rate.

A physiological term called tidal volume (Vt or TV) is used to indicate how much air is generally moved during inspiration and expiration when you are at rest. Spirometry, a non-invasive test, is used to measure it. Adults breathe on average seven milliliters (mL) every kilogram (kg) of ideal body weight.

When it comes to configuring the ventilator in critically ill patients, tidal volume is crucial. Delivering a tidal volume that is both large enough to sustain proper breathing and small enough to prevent lung trauma is the objective.
